Restaurant recommendation

My wife and I are arriving in Florence end of August. I would like to get a recommendation for authentic bistecca fiorentina? My only requirements is that I want a place where locals go with better quality meats. I don’t want a touristy place I prefer authentic Italian. I hear going to the Oltrano area is best but there’s still so many choices.

Thank you!

Recommended in earlier threads on this Forum, the Antico Ristoro di Cambi is an institution in the Oltrarno. We went there years ago, and it was very good. Rick Steves has recommended it, so it might not be strictly locals in there with you, but it’s also far from touristy.

We recently returned from our July Italy trip. In Florence we stayed 3 nights at the Hotel Maxim Axial on Via dei Calzaiuoli, just a few minutes' walk from the Duomo. At my request for a good, non-touristy, nearby restaurant for bistecca alla Fiorentina, Sabrina (at the reception desk) recommended Agricola Toscana, (agricolatoscana.com) which was only about a 5 minute walk from the hotel and from the Duomo. Turned out to be one of the best dining experiences of our 18 day travels through IL Bel Paese. Adriana, who was in charge, welcomed us warmly. Our big t-bone was brought out for our approval before it was cooked "al sangue" (rare), the only way they cook it! After a short time it was presented already neatly carved and accompanied by perfectly roasted potatoes. Absolutely delicious, perfectly prepared, beautifully presented, top quality food in a relaxed, unpretentious, warm environment in the heart of Firenze. Everyone on the staff was very friendly and attentive. Would go back in a heartbeat. Wish Agricola Toscana was located where I live! Grazie mille to Sabrina for recommending Agricola Toscana and for calling and ensuring we got a table, even at close to last minute.

Trattoria La Burrasca The Florentine steak served at this modest restaurant is terrific! I sensed several locals were also eating there.
